Abstract

Mobile learning has outstanding characteristics including situational correlation, real-time and interaction, so it is suitable for continuing medical education. On the base of current status of mobile learning and information teaching in medical continuing education, we analyze the necessity of mobile learning and how to construct mobile learning platform and promote the application of mobile learning in medical continuing education on the aspects of building mobile learning platform, the development of mobile learning resources and the selection of mobile terminal aspects.
